Requires that $3 million of the funds appropriated to Forsyth Technical Community College (College) in 2005-06 for construction of the Center for Emerging Technologies be transferred to the state treasurer to a specified budget code, to be administered by the NC Community Colleges System Office (Office). Requires the Office to allocate up to $300,000 of the funds each fiscal year to the College, until the funds are expended, for the operating costs of the College's biotechnology, nanotechnology, design, and advanced information technology programs; Small Business Center; and corporate and industrial training programs. Prohibits additional state funds from being made available to the College for those purposes. Effective July 1, 2013.
